Output 63161e754a27fbd9739a89a6dc02a0a603bae94f87b20972b6fec9dbde32550d:5

value
4389292
script pubkey
OP_0 OP_PUSHBYTES_20 d4b757b691ce7a344ea78aaf38f40c64ebb85d9e
address
bc1q6jm40d53eeargn4832hn3aqvvn4mshv74uzlug
transaction
63161e754a27fbd9739a89a6dc02a0a603bae94f87b20972b6fec9dbde32550d
spent
true